Let me know what you think? I and others have worked hard to make a rig that will work in some of the toughest areas. I will have detailed pics of all the mods later. The exo is almost finished. Still adding Gerry Can holders along with high lift jack holders. We are going to add more tubing to the roof section. We are currently fabbing some some quick release pull pins for the rear tire drop down.
List Of Mods:
35x12.50BFG MT's
Pro Comp 17x9 Wheels
AllPRO LIFT Package
AllPRO DIFF Protection
AllPRO IFS and Trans Skid
AllPRO High Clearance Exhaust
AllPRO Front and Rear Bumper
FST Fabrication Exo Cage
FST Fabrication Body Mounts/Rear BumpStop Extensions
FST Rear Tire Carrier with Quick Release

Does the cage offer rollover protection, or does it serve as an elaborate curb feeler, albeit for rocks and trees?
 
Does the cage offer rollover protection, or does it serve as an elaborate curb feeler, albeit for rocks and trees?

It is a sturdy cage able to defend against rocks and trees. As far as rollovers I would say no. The front nose will protect the radiator and the cage will offer serious support but a rollover would be a different story. The cage attaches to the front and rear bumpers and to the rock sliders. I couldnt attach the cage directly to the frame because I need it to flex as much as possible.
It is for keeping the body safe. It comes off in two pieces. It has felt rocks and trees and has kept the car safe and got me home to play another day. I weigh 300lbs and can stand anywhere on the cage and it will not flex.
